Lot 1039
18th &19th century Tennessee ephemera,
Sign In to see what this sold for
35 hand written items, 1796-1893, mostly Washington County, Tennessee origin: James White (founder of Knoxville), signed letter to Court of Equity, stains, losses, fading; 1880 letter regarding Civil War wounds of Andrew J. Mase, Co. E, 1st Reg't. Tenn. Lite Artillery; court documents, receipts, ledger, 1776 discharge of Sgt. David Owens, letters, instructions; folds, creases, separations, losses, stains, soiling, browning, fading throughout, 2-1/4 x 7-1/2" to 13-1/2 to 8-1/4"
